    Description


    The Customer Success Manager drives innovative strategies and customer success plans which deepen customer understanding, responds to changing customer expectations, develops new opportunities an delivery world class customer experiences.

    This role ensures end to end orchestration of the customer success plan, leads and coordinates program activities and resources for maximizing customer satisfaction from pre-acquisition to expansion and renewal, influences and nurtures the strategic relationship by understanding the customer objectives and how to help realize them.

    Become a trusted advisor and partner of choice and

    transform healthcare delivery by tackling the most challenging clinical and business issues across the continuum of care.


    Your role:


    The Customer Success Manager directs and guides the activities of customer delivery programs consisting of multiple and interdependent projects executed to contribute to the program's delivery of its intended benefits.

    They lead multiple project teams from different parts of the organization to deliver customer benefits and organizational objectives.

    Depending on the program's goal and objectives, the program manager works for and collaborates with many stakeholders, cross-functional and cross-business, with a variety of expertise and responsibilities.
